Turkey Denounces Attack On Ataturk's Statue In US

29.06.2020 22:57

Such 'ugly acts cannot overshadow' Turkey's glorious history, memories of Ataturk, says foreign ministry spokesman.

Turkey on Monday decried the attack targeting the statue of country's founder Mustafa Kemal Ataturk in the US.

On the recent attack on Ataturk's statue in front of Turkey's Washington Embassy residence, foreign ministry spokesman Hami Aksoy said that such "ugly acts cannot overshadow" the country's glorious history and the memories of the great leader Ataturk.

"In order to launch an investigation into the perpetrators of this atrocious action, our Washington Embassy took necessary initiatives with the US authorities," Aksoy said in a written statement.

The attack targeting the bronze statue of Ataturk took place in the US capital on June 25. -
